论文部分内容阅读
考试是教学至关重要的一个环节。随着时代的进步和科技的发展,考试的方法也不断发展变化。传统的考试方法费时费力,各环节容易存在安全隐患。随着计算机的普及以及网络性能的提高,将传统的考试模式与先进的网络应用相结合,出现了使用计算机作为考试工具的计算机考试系统。计算机考试系统与传统考试系统相比有很多的优点:可以实现教考分离,有利于提高教学质量,对教学改革起到了积极的推动作用;缩短了整个考试过程;减轻了出题者、应试者和试卷评阅者的劳动强度,提高了效率;减少了由于人为因素造成的错误;可以有效地杜绝作弊,提高了考试的安全性和公平性。计算机考试系统在发展过程中虽然功能逐渐完善,可以集培训,学习和考试于一体,同时向商品化发展,但是考试系统在安全方面还有不足之处,存在一定的安全漏洞,整个考试过程的安全还有待于进一步提高。本论文介绍我在完善考试系统功能的同时,着重从安全方面来设计考试系统。网络考试系统一般采用的主要安全技术有信息加密、防火墙、入侵检测技术等,这些技术在一定程度上保证了考试系统的安全。但是,面对复杂而又不断变化的网络安全问题,传统的模型和技术存在致命的缺陷——用静态、精确的形式化理论去解决动态变化的网络考试系统的安全问题,缺乏自适应性、多样性等。我们必须寻求新的安全技术来提高考试系统的安全性,而生物免疫系统能够保证机体安全,它具有自适应性、多样性、多层性、分布性等许多特性,而这些特性是生物安全的重要保证。生物界的安全特性正是传统考试系统所缺乏的。为此,我们将生物免疫系统的免疫思想应用到考试系统,同时采用传统的用户认证技术、访问控制技术、数据加密技术、防火墙技术,入侵检测技术,防病毒技术等,设计了基于免疫网络安全考试系统。该系统将传统的静态防御方法和新的动态防御方法——生物免疫技术结合在一起,可以很好地解决考试系统的安全问题,且是一种多层次的、分布式的、主动与被动防护结合的安全系统。它采用了免疫的部分原理,进行自适应防护,增强了系统的稳定性和安全性,提高了系统的容错性。该系统在保证考试系统安全、学生操作方便、快捷的同时,还可以使相关的考试部门更好地利用现有资源,节约一定的经费。